Police: Milwaukee Sander and Hand Tools Found Behind the Bushes at First Unitarian Church; 12-Year-Old Boy Chased Another Boy With a Stick; Identify Fraud Reported
Excerpts from the Beverly Police Department log.

Friday, April 17
At 1:46 a.m., dispute on Clifton Avenue. Cab driver-fare dispute. Situation resolved.
At 6:07 a.m., walk-in to station reported identity fraud.

At 7:18 a.m., directed patrol om Bridge Street and Kernwood Avenue. Monitoring school traffic.
At 8:42 a.m., motor vehicle accident with damage on Elliott Street and McPherson Drive. Report taken.

At 12:53 p.m., report of possible break and enter in Cabot Street.
At 3:29 p.m., motor vehicle stop on Rantoul Street and Fayette Street. Warning given for brake light violation.
At 3:47 p.m., hand tools found on Cabot Street. Milwaukee sander and hand tools found behind the bushes at First Unitarian Church.
At 4:49 p.m., suspicious activity on South Hardy Street and Fayette Street. Reports of a 12-year-old boy chasing another boy with a stick. Boys were spoken to, and they agreed to stay away from each other.
At 4:51 p.m., commercial alarm on Otis Road. Instant alarm called in for side door. Employee accidentally set the alarm off.
